>>18115395That's just German and Dutch next to each other.Echtes Leder (real leather in German)Futter (lining in German) 100% polyester Echt Leer (real leather in Dutch)Voering (lining in Dutch) 100% polyester.You can't get polyester (PE) to look like leather pleather is usually polyurethane (PU or PUR), polylactide (PLA) or polyvinyl chloride (PVC).>>18114504>I think it looks fineYou're wrong. >>18134190Well the short of it is that punk fashion in it's infancy was meant to be very cheap and working class, think Sex Pistols. When it hit the mainstream, the high brow fashion houses wanted to cash in and made expensive products for rich people who wanted to look punk, but didn't understand that in essence and at it's core punk was about rebelling against the mainstream, safe, posh culture that looked down on themSubcultures are mostly dead but there is still a fine divide between 'being' and 'posing'
